Watering Gala Apple and Lychee

Water is the most essential need of any plant. Watering requirements differ for every plant. Knowing the amount of water required is the most important part of Gala Apple and Lychee Facts. One needs to adequately water the plants keeping in mind that plants need season wise variations in water levels. While taking Gala Apple and Lychee care, it is important to know that too much water is more dangerous than not enough watering. Here we provide you with the exact watering required for your garden plant. Watering Gala Apple and Lychee is as follows:

  • Watering Gala Apple in Summer: Alternate Days

  • Watering Gala Apple in Winter: Less Watering

  • Watering Lychee in Summer: Lots of watering

  • Watering Lychee in Winter: Regular watering required

Gala Apple and Lychee Pruning

Pruning is an important part of Gala Apple and Lychee care. Pruning helps to grow the plant with a faster rate. Gala Apple and Lychee pruning is done as follows:

  • Gala Apple pruning: Prune central stem and Remove lateral branches

  • Lychee pruning: Prune after harvesting, Prune lower leaves and Prune to control growth

Plants need fertilizers for its growth and increasing the life. Gala Apple and Lychee fertilizers are as follows:

  • Gala Apple fertilizers: Apply 10-10-10 amount, fertilize in growing season and Fertilize the soil before planting
  • Lychee fertilizers: All-Purpose Liquid Fertilizer and Fertilize after blooming period
